Sunderland striker Brian Brobbey was full of praise for the home fans, hailing them as the '12th man' following their 3-2 come back win over Bournemouth on Saturday (November 29).

Sunderland went 2-0 down after just 15 minutes thanks to goals from Amine Adli and a wonderful strike from midfielder Tyler Adams.

Enzo Le Fee got one back from the penalty spot just after the half hour mark, before Bertrand Traore restored parity almost immediately after the break.

Brobbey, 23, scored the eventual winner in the 69th minute, one week after scoring a dramatic equaliser in the 2-2 draw with Arsenal.

Speaking to reporters after the game, Brobbey was full of praise for the home fans, saying: "We always keep fighting for each other until the very end and that's what we did today.

"It was even better (than the goal vs Arsenal) and it feels really good to score the winning goal so I'm happy.

"The fans are like the 12th man, they are really behind you so it gives you a lot of confidence to keep going."
